手记

列表中两个元素交换--

L=['a','b','c','d']#将第一个和第三个元素交换
L[0],L[2]=L[2],L[0]#将第一个和第三个先取出再进行交换
print L

列表的方法:
L.append(VAL)------添加最后一项
L.insert(index,val)------插入某项值为VAL
L.pop()-------删除最后一项并返回删除值
L.pop(x)-------删除第x项,并返回删除值
L[X]='VAL'----更新x项的值


待更新
两个列表合并:

L=['A','B','C']
N=[1,2,3]
S=zip.(L,N)
print S
#输出[('A'1),('B',2),('C',3)]
#迭代输出:
for index name in S:
    print name,'-->',index
2人推荐
随时随地看视频
慕课网APP